Default 2010 electronics problem?

I have a 2010 HS and have been having intermittent problems with the electronics. Sometimes when I push the am/fm band button the power goes off. A couple times when I used the volume buttons on the steering wheel it changed the radio station. It often won't recognize my ipod when it's connected. Sometimes the audio goes off entirely and it won't turn on again for ten minutes or so. The Navigation also has gotten slower at voice recognition. But until these get frequent enough to reliably reproduce at the dealer, I can't get them fixed. My concern is the expense of this when it ultimately fails, and I am coming to the end of my factory warranty.
I am not sure whether to buy an extended warranty, sell the car, or just hope it never goes completely bust.
Any suggestions?

Make sure it's documented at the dealer. I had a similar situation where my GPS in my sienna would randomly have difficulty reading the disk and show static on the screen. The dealer was never able to reproduce the issue so they could not get authorization to replace it. I even made a video recording when it happened and supplied it to the dealer, but that still was not enough proof. A few months after the warranty expired the player completely stopped reading the disk. I had to call extended warranty and the finally approved the replacement since the issue was well documented before the warranty expired. I can't guarantee you will have the same experience, however they assured me that if I had not had it documented they would not have replaced it. And I believe them.
